Tidex

Tidex was established in October of 2017 and operates on the Waves blockchain. The exchange is known for its user-friendly interface, low fees, and availability of over 100 trading pairs.

The location of the company is not specified on the website of the exchange. According to some online resources, the exchange is located in the United Kingdom, while others list the Cayman Islands as the company's country of incorporation. The company is believed to be managed by Elite Way Development LLP.

The website of exchange is available in English, Chinese, French, and Russian. The exchange does not permit margin trading or the use of fiat currencies. The exchange's intuitive interface and application programming interface (API) enable trading on multiple platforms. Additional features include USDT loans, staking, and the ability to send specific amounts of coins to specific users using unique codes.

Tidex supports over 90 cryptocurrencies including the set of Waves-based tokens. Over 90 cryptocurrencies, including Waves-based tokens, are supported by Tidex. Fiat currencies are not supported. Users may choose to purchase stablecoins that are pegged to multiple national currencies. Tidex provides Tether (USDT), as well as WUSD and WEUR. Tidex only supports market orders, while limit orders are not available. 

Tidex users can also earn rewards via staking of both Tidex and Waves tokens. Another option available for Tidex users is staking USDT. 

Tidex offers transparently competitive trading fees. Both makers and takers are required to pay 0.1%. In addition, users who participate in the Tidex loyalty program pay lower trading fees. As for withdrawal fees, each coin has its own fixed withdrawal fees and minimum withdrawal amount on this exchange.

The website asserts that security is Tidex's top priority, but there is insufficient information about the security methods employed by the exchange team. Two-factor authentication is supported. It is unknown whether the website is resistant to DDoS attacks or how many coins are stored in cold wallets.
